Using an EVGA 880GTS 640 superclocked with the latest drivers and nTune from the Nvidia website.

Through nTune I change the clock speeds for the core and memory to 620/1100. Click apply, and even save the profile. This runs stable through all benchmarks and torture testing.

The problem I have is that when I reboot my system, it's not keeping the settings, it defaults back to the manufacturer's defaults of 576/850.

Does anyone have any thoughts or advice on how to get this to stick through a reboot? The only reason I'm rebooting is that I don't want to leave my system on throughout the day when I'm not using it.
